in在编程里什么意思
-
在编程中,"in"是一个关键字,用于表示在某个范围内进行操作或判断。它可以用于不同的编程语言和上下文中,具有不同的含义和用法。
-
在循环中的使用:在循环语句中,"in"通常用来遍历集合、数组或迭代器中的元素。例如,在Python中可以使用"for item in collection"的语法来遍历集合中的每个元素,其中的"in"表示在集合中。
-
在条件语句中的使用:在条件语句中,"in"可以用来检查某个元素是否存在于某个集合中。例如,在Python中可以使用"if item in collection"的语法来判断集合中是否包含某个元素,其中的"in"表示在集合中。
-
在迭代器中的使用:在某些编程语言中,如C#和Java,"in"可以用来遍历迭代器中的元素。例如,在C#中可以使用"foreach (var item in iterator)"的语法来遍历迭代器中的每个元素,其中的"in"表示在迭代器中。
-
在列表推导中的使用:在一些函数式编程语言中,如Python和Scala,"in"可以用来生成新的列表。例如,在Python中可以使用"[x for x in range(10)]"的语法来生成一个包含0到9的列表,其中的"in"表示在范围内。
总之,"in"在编程中通常表示在某个范围内进行操作或判断,具体用法和含义取决于编程语言和上下文。
1年前 -
-
在编程中,"in"通常有以下几种含义:
-
在循环中使用:在循环语句中,"in"通常用于遍历集合或迭代器中的元素。例如,可以使用"for item in list"来遍历列表中的每个元素。
-
在条件语句中使用:在条件语句中,"in"可以用于检查一个元素是否存在于一个集合中。例如,可以使用"if item in list"来检查列表中是否存在某个元素。
-
在列表生成式中使用:在列表生成式中,"in"用于指定迭代的范围。例如,可以使用"[x**2 for x in range(5)]"来生成一个包含0到4的平方数的列表。
-
在字符串中使用:在字符串中,"in"可以用于检查一个子字符串是否存在于一个字符串中。例如,可以使用"if 'hello' in string"来检查字符串中是否包含"hello"。
-
在集合操作中使用:在集合操作中,"in"可以用于判断一个元素是否属于一个集合。例如,可以使用"if element in set"来判断一个元素是否属于一个集合。
总之,"in"在编程中常常用于循环、条件判断、列表生成、字符串匹配和集合操作等场景中。它是一种常用的语法结构,用于处理集合中的元素。
1年前 -
-
在编程中,"in"通常有以下几种含义:
-
用于循环遍历:在很多编程语言中,"in"关键字用于循环遍历数据结构中的元素。例如,在Python中,可以使用"for item in list"的语法来依次访问列表中的每个元素。类似地,在C#中,可以使用"foreach (var item in collection)"的语法来遍历集合中的元素。
-
用于判断成员关系:有些编程语言中,"in"关键字可以用于判断一个元素是否属于某个集合。例如,在Python中,可以使用"if item in list"的语法来判断一个元素是否存在于列表中。类似地,在C#中,可以使用"if (item in collection)"的语法来判断一个元素是否存在于集合中。
-
用于迭代器:在一些编程语言中,"in"关键字用于定义迭代器。迭代器是一种用于访问集合中元素的对象,它可以按照特定的顺序逐个返回集合中的元素。通过使用"in"关键字定义迭代器,我们可以使用简洁的语法来遍历集合中的元素。
-
用于输入输出:在一些编程语言中,"in"关键字可以用于输入输出操作。例如,在Python中,可以使用"input()"函数来获取用户的输入,然后使用"in"关键字判断用户的输入是否满足特定条件。类似地,在C#中,可以使用"Console.ReadLine()"方法获取用户的输入,然后使用"in"关键字进行判断。
总之,"in"关键字在编程中有多种含义,具体的意义取决于所使用的编程语言和上下文。在不同的情况下,"in"关键字可能具有不同的功能和用法。要正确理解和使用"in"关键字,需要根据具体的编程语言和语法规则进行学习和掌握。
1年前 -